Zusammenfassung: | A SRCES (Single-Roll Caster Equipped with a Scraper) was devised in order to improve the free-solidified surface. A scraper contacted to the free-solidified surface at the constant force. The some amount of semisolid metal on the solid layer was removed and the surface condition becomes flat. The melt pool was mounted on the top of the roll. Therefore, the scraper was easily operated. In our study, aluminum alloy strip was cast by the SRCES. The scraped surface condition of the cast strip was investigated. The as-cast strip could be cold-rolled and the roughness of the free-solidified surface was reduced. There was no difference between the free-solidified surface and roll-contact surface after cold-rolling. The cross-section of the as-cast strip was observed. The porosity of the free-solidified surface was less than the porosity at center area of the strip cast by a TRC (Twin-Roll Caster). The mechanical properties of the cast strip were investigated by deep-drawing test and tensile test. As a result of deep-drawing test, there was no difference between the free-solidified surface and the roll-contact surface after cold-rolling. As a result of tensile test, mechanical properties of cold-rolled strips were similar to the strip cast by the D.C.casting. These result shows that the free-solidified surface could be improved up to the roll-contact surface by the scraper and cold-rolling. |
